Photoshop Interface Assistant 1.1 [Homepage] - by: GoldSolution Software, Inc. - Download links ![]() Click to enlarge Description: Adobe Photoshop has a drawback in its interface, it uses several floating palettes and toolbars which occupy precious screen space for design. But you can't close these floating windows because they are indispensable for graphic design. So you have to minimize and restore these floating windows repeatedly to get more screen space for design. This tends to interrupt the creative continuity of the user. Photoshop Interface Assistant offers a solution to overcome the conflict between more screen space and work continuity. When you don't use the floating windows currently, it automatically moves them to the edge of the screen to give you the maximum available screen space for design; when you want to use these floating palettes and toolbars, just move cursor on any of them and they will automatically restore into your vision for usage. Photoshop Interface Assistant improves your work efficiency and really gives you more pleasure in design.
